Helsingborg Symphony Orchestra is one of the oldest orchestras in Sweden, founded in 1912. It was originally of the size of a chamber orchestra but today numbers some 51 musicians, giving some sixty concerts a year, in Helsingborg and the southern areas of Sweden. In 1988 the orchestra undertook its first foreign tour with a visit to Berlin, followed by tours to Poland and the then Czechoslovakia and subsequently to the United States of America and to Spain. The German conductor Hans-Peter Frank directed the orchestra throughout the 1980s and in 1991 Okko Kamu was appointed chief conductor.
